About this app

PeerOnCall is a peer support app designed by and for Canadian public safety personnel. It provides information and support for managing users’ mental health with resources, tips to cope, and peer wisdom videos. Users can also connect to trained peer supporters of their choice via secure, private text or voice chat. PeerOnCall is not intended to replace crisis services or professional support; however, local resources and supports can be found throughout the app. All information is private and confidential.
